ODE TO THE aussie shed

There’s no doubt Aussies are a hardworking bunch. Whether you are kid wrangling or organising corporate takeovers, there’s nothing quite like a long cool drink and relaxing in your own happy place when the day is done. Creating a space to call your own is important. Whether it’s a custom-designed shed, a pool room to playfully hustle your friends or a family games room to make lasting memories, the choice is yours. Australians love creating warm intimate spaces at home that are a unique reflection of who they are.
